Warby Parker has teamed up with experimental musician Beck on these limited edition styles of their ‘Carmichael’ frame to coincide with the release of his album, Song Reader (for those who don’t know, the entire album was released as sheet music so fans could play/record/interpret Beck’s music). Meant to look a “bit bookish and bohemian,” with round lenses and a keyhole bridge, the style is available in both optical and sunglass versions.
